Taking clear inspiration from Toyota's award-winning GT86 the FT-1 is a slick collage of striking lines, blades and air ducts all crammed into a supercar View source website
Read more →Taking clear inspiration from Toyota's award-winning GT86 the FT-1 is a slick collage of striking lines, blades and air ducts all crammed into a supercar View source website
Read more →